Camcorder Guerrillas Programme


The Camcorder Guerillas are a community- based, voluntary collective of film-makers, artists and activists who donate their time and skills to produce, screen and distribute films and video toolkits for campaigning groups and those concerned with human rights, welfare and social justice initiatives. Their films are designed to enable individuals and communities to come together, get informed and take action in solidarity with those who are disadvantaged or face discrimination. Camcorder Guerillas will be screening their new film Deadly Cargo, alongside a programme of other films and speakers looking at Nuclear Weapons and their impact on our society.

Deadly Cargo
Scotland 2008 / 18 Mins

Fully-assembled nuclear weapons are regularly transported in secret convoys on ordinary roads, day and night, right across Britain. How close do they come to you?

Find out the chilling truth about these lethal convoys, and how they are tracked by the Nukewatch network.

The authorities ask us to keep an eye out for suspicious-looking bags at train stations; Nukewatch ask us to keep an eye out for suspicious-looking trucks carrying Weapons of Mass Destruction on our motorways.
